I’ve mentioned several times in my classes that I’m a Tide girl.  Our little family only uses 3 or 4 of the 32 load bottles in a year’s time and when I can get it for $2.50 I’m not going to worry about saving that little amount by using a different product.  I was just over at amit19 and noticed that Tide powder is included in the gas card deal for 8/28-9/3.  The deal looks like this:

Buy 1 Dawn dish soap @ .99
Buy 5 Tide powder @ 5.94 each = $29.70
subtotal: $30.69

use (4) $2/1 Tide powder from 7/17 SS (can only use 4 like coupons per shopping trip)
use (1) $.50/1 dawn from 7/31 PG
new total: $22.19
get back $10 gas card
total after gas card: $12.19
subtract $.49 for the dawn = $11.70 for 5 tide (2.34 each!)


These Qs all expire on Wednesday 8/31, so keep that in mind.  You’ll need to buy all the items in the same transaction to get the gas card so you may want to ask your store to place an order for you.

    I was wondering how do you stretch 3 or 4 32oz bottles of Tide for the year? Do you also buy other detergent or do you add something else to the tide to make it stretch so you won’t have to use so much. Just wondering

  4. Hi Anon,
    Tide really suds up (have you ever let it agitate with no clothes for a min? OMG) So I’ve found that unless the clothes are really grimy I can use just under the #1 line for a full load of laundry and that will be enough. A 32 load bottle is more like 36 – 38 loads. Since it’s just my husband and I, a 3 yr old who wears size 2 and a baby, I typically do 2 loads of laundry one week and 3 the next. That’s 130 loads a year and about 3 and a half bottles at the rate I use it.
